About The Position

Timmons Group is currently seeking an experienced Civil Project Engineer III candidate to join our Stormwater Group located in our Charlotte, NC office location. This role involves performing hydrologic and hydraulic analyses, designing stormwater control measures, and managing projects.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in water resources engineering and proficiency in relevant modeling software.

Responsibilities

  • Perform hydrologic and hydraulic analyses to investigate storm drainage issues and support stormwater management designs
  • Complete calculations using engineering formulas and skills and/or utilizes computers in order to solve problems with HEC-RAS, HEC-HMS, SWMM models.
  • Provide engineering assistance for the design of stormwater control measures, stormwater retrofit designs and other stormwater related projects
  • Conduct background research on technical issues and write clear reports and memorandums to convey project results to our clients
  • Assist in the preparation of engineering and construction cost estimates
  • Participate in field data collection and construction observation duties as directed
  • Communicate with clients and internal design team as directed by the Project Manager
